A homeless man’s three-story treehouse crafted from scrap materials near downtown Los Angeles has been torn down by the city—but this setback has not deterred the enterprising architect.
The elevated makeshift home—with a bedroom, a loft, and a zip line—went viral last month, when a TikTok video captured the structure in all its ramshackle glory, drawing more than 340,000 views.
But the arboreal abode’s moment in the spotlight proved short-lived: A week ago, city workers descended on the South L.A. neighborhood and dismantled the improvised living space, along with other shelters making up a nearby street-level homeless encampment…
